Foothill Oak Elementary School, a public school located in Vista, CA, serves grades K-5 in the Vista Unified School District.It has received a GreatSchools Rating of 2 out of 10, based on a variety of school quality measures.
Foothill Oak Elementary School is a public school located in Vista, CA. 556 students attend Foothill Oak Elementary School.

| Test Scores | 1/10 | The Test Score Rating examines how students at this school performed on standardized tests compared with other schools in the state. The Test Rating was created using 2025 California Assessment of Student Performance and Progress (CAASPP) data from California Department of Education, and using 2025 California Science Test data from California Department of Education. |
| Student Growth | 2/10 | The Student Progress Rating measures whether students at this school are making academic progress over time based on student growth data provided by the Department of Education. Specifically, this rating looks at how much progress individual students have made on state assessments during the past year or more, how this performance aligns with expected progress based on a student growth model established by the state Department of Education, and how this school's growth data compares to other schools in the state. The Growth Rating was created using 2025 Student growth data from California Department of Education. |
